3. Basic Elements of Communication
System
● Message – information such as data like text, picture, sound, video
etc are to be communicated
● Sender - Creates and sends a message
● Medium – Carries the message
● Receiver – Receives the message
● Protocol – set of rules that govern data communication

4. Data Transmission Mode
● There are three modes of data
transmission
○ Simplex
○ Half Duplex
○ Full Duplex

6. Simplex
● Transmission of data in only one direction
is known as simplex transmission mode
● Devices used in such communication
system are either read only or send only.

8. Half Duplex
● A communication system in which we can
transmit data in both directions but in only
one direction at a time.
● It alternates sender and receiver.
